Construction Laborers Salary in Grand Rapids, MI
BLS Occupational Employment & Wage Statistics • May 2025 • Grand Rapids-Wyoming-Kentwood, MI

In Grand Rapids, MI, construction laborers earn a median annual salary of $48,340, which translates to approximately $23.24 per hour. This figure is slightly above the national median for this occupation, which stands at $46,730. When compared to the local household income in Grand Rapids, which averages $80,296 annually, the earnings of construction laborers represent a significant portion but not an equivalent amount. The difference highlights the challenges faced by individuals solely relying on such wages to support a typical family, especially considering that two incomes are often necessary to reach or exceed the area's median household income.
For entry-level workers in this field, salaries tend to start around the 10th percentile mark of $37,000 annually, while those with more experience and skills can earn up to the 75th percentile at about $58,610 per year. Workers at the higher end of the spectrum, specifically in the 90th percentile, can earn approximately $63,760 annually. How much do Construction Laborers make per hour in Grand Rapids?
The median hourly wage for Construction Laborers in Grand Rapids, MI is $23.24,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$32.01 or more per hour.
Is Grand Rapids above or below average for Construction Laborers salaries?
The median Construction Laborers salary in Grand Rapids, MI is 3.4% above the national median of $46,730.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.
What is the entry-level salary for Construction Laborers in Grand Rapids?
Entry-level Construction Laborers (10th percentile) earn around $37,000 per year in Grand Rapids, MI.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$41,870.
